2026-04-22
Reuters 5 related

Australia's eSafety Commissioner issues transparency notices to Roblox, Microsoft's Minecraft, and other online gaming platforms to detail child safety measures

Australia's internet regulator on Wednesday asked online gaming platforms including Roblox (RBLX.N) and Microsoft's (MSFT.O) …

2026-01-16
New York Times 25 related

Australia's eSafety Commissioner reports social media platforms “removed access” to ~4.7M accounts under its ban for under-16s, which took effect in December

Governments around the world are watching the rollout of the landmark law, which made it illegal for those under 16 to have accounts.

2025-12-10
The Guardian 4 related

Australia eSafety Commissioner Julie Inman Grant says under-16s slipping through the cracks of the social media ban will be “booted off” the platforms in time

Albanese says commencement of ban a ‘proud day’ for him as prime minister, while eSafety commissioner unconcerned by reports of children bypassing restrictions

2024-06-05
The Register 11 related

Australia's eSafety commissioner ends the legal action asking X to remove a video of a clergyman's stabbing; Musk labelled the action an assault on free speech

Australia's eSafety commissioner has ended legal action that aimed to compel social network X to take down a video depicting …

2024-05-13
Wall Street Journal 9 related

An Australian judge refuses the eSafety commissioner's request to extend an order for X to hide a video of a religious leader's stabbing, without giving reasons
